What is a French Press?
A French press, also known as a press pot or plunger pot, is a coffee brewing method that uses a cylindrical glass or stainless-steel vessel with a plunger and a metal or mesh filter. It is known for extracting the essential oils and flavors from coffee beans effectively, resulting in a bolder cup of coffee. Unlike automatic machines that may require paper filters, a French press allows coffee enthusiasts to enjoy an unfiltered brew that maximizes flavor and aroma.

How to Brew the Perfect Cup with Kichly French Press
Brewing coffee with the Kichly 8-Cup French Press can be an art form. Here’s a step-by-step guide to creating the perfect brew:
Ingredients
- Coarse coffee grounds (about 1 oz or 28 grams for an 8-cup press)
- Freshly boiled water (around 200°F)
Brewing Steps
-
Measure Coffee: Start with approximately 1 ounce of coarse coffee grounds for 8 cups of water. Adjust based on taste preferences.
-
Add Water: Pour freshly boiled water over the coffee grounds, filling the French press.
-
Stir: Gently stir the mixture using a wooden or plastic spoon to ensure an even extraction.
-
Steep: Place the lid on the French press with the plunger pulled up and allow the coffee to steep for about 4 minutes.
-
Press: Slowly press down the plunger with even pressure to separate the coffee grounds from the liquid.
-
Serve: Pour your freshly brewed coffee into your favorite mug and enjoy!
Tips for the Best Brew
- Use freshly ground coffee for the best flavor.
- Experiment with steeping time to find your preferred strength.
- Clean the press thoroughly after each use to maintain quality and flavor.

Q2: How should I clean my French press?
A2: Disassemble the French press and rinse the components under hot water. You can also wash them with a mild dish soap. Ensure all coffee oils and grounds are removed for optimal performance.
Q3: Can I brew coffee in advance and store it?
A3: While freshly brewed coffee is best consumed immediately, if you must store it, keep it in an insulated container. Coffee brewed in a French press will go stale quicker than other methods due to oxidation.
Q4: What grind size should I use for French press coffee?
A4: Coarse coffee grounds are ideal for a French press. Finer grounds can clog the filter and result in a bitter brew.
